    Arbail Shivaram Hebbar is an Indian politician who is the Minister of the Labour Department of Karnataka since 6 February 2020. He was elected to the Karnataka Legislative Assembly from Yellapura in the 2018 Karnataka Legislative Assembly election as a member of the Indian National Congress but switched to Bharatiya Janata Party in 2019 and won ...

    The Karnataka Council of Ministers is the executive wing of the Government of Karnataka and is headed by the Chief Minister of Karnataka, who is the head of government and leader of the state cabinet. The term of every executive wing is for 5 years. The council of ministers are assisted by bureaucrats headed by the respective department secretaries often from the Indian Administrative Service ...

    The Government of Karnataka, abbreviated as GoK or GoKA, formerly known as Government of Mysore (1956–1974), is a democratically elected state body with the governor as the ceremonial head to govern the Southwest Indian state of Karnataka. The governor who is appointed for five years appoints the chief minister and on the advice of the chief minister appoints their council of ministers. Even ...

    Santosh Shivaji Lad (born 27 February 1975) is an Indian politician from Karnataka. He is currently serving as Cabinet Minister in Government of Karnataka, and is a member of Karnataka Legislative Assembly representing Kalghatgi-Alnavar constituency in the Dharwad district of Karnataka state.
